For Me The Jasmine Buds Unfold Poem Rhyme Scheme and Analysis
Rhyme Scheme: ABABCDCD EBEBBDBDFor me the jasmine buds unfold | A |
And silver daisies star the lea | B |
The crocus hoards the sunset gold | A |
And the wild rose breathes for me | B |
I feel the sap through the bough returning | C |
I share the skylark's transport fine | D |
I know the fountain's wayward yearning | C |
I love and the world is mine | D |
- | |
I love and thoughts that sometime grieved | E |
Still well remembered grieve not me | B |
From all that darkened and deceived | E |
Upsoars my spirit free | B |
For soft the hours repeat one story | B |
Sings the sea one strain divine | D |
My clouds arise all flushed with glory | B |
I love and the world is mine | D |
Florence Earle Coates
